Why you need a Digital Marketing Agency in Japan

Japan isn’t “another APAC market.” It runs on its own rules. Search is split: Google leads, yet Yahoo! JAPAN still matters and behaves differently. Social isn’t a copy-paste from the West either: LINE is the daily habit, YouTube and X move culture, while Facebook is niche. Add language nuance, honorifics, and customers who research carefully before they act.
A Japan-native agency helps you:
- Pick the right channels (Google and Yahoo! JAPAN; LINE, YouTube, X) and set the budget mix that actually converts.
- Localize for trust, not just translate—keywords, copy, CTAs, and on-site UX that feel naturally Japanese.
- Move fast with facts—test, learn, and iterate weekly against clear KPIs, not assumptions.
- Stay compliant and credible across platforms, privacy rules, and local ad norms.
Bottom line: if you want real traction here, you need a partner who speaks the language—of the platforms and the people.

Dentsu Digital — Enterprise scale, local precision
If you need a one-stop partner for nationwide, multi-channel marketing in Japan, Dentsu Digital is the safe pair of hands. It’s the digital arm of Dentsu and runs end-to-end programs—from strategy and creative to media, CX/CRM, data, and AI. Their Global Center fields 150+ multilingual specialists to help international brands localize without losing global consistency.
What they do well
plan and execute large campaigns across Google + Yahoo! JAPAN, LINE, YouTube, TikTok, Meta, TV/OOH—then tie it all back to data, automation, and measurement. Founded in 2016, the team blends enterprise process with new tech.
Best for
Fortune-level or well-funded entrants that need scale, governance, and cross-channel orchestration—not just siloed tactics. If your brief is “go big in Japan with proof,” they have the people and the pipes to deliver.
KYODO PR — Japan’s PR pioneer, now fully digital
If you need brand credibility and reach in Japan, KYODO PR is a strong pick. Founded in 1964, it’s one of Japan’s leading independent PR firms and today runs an integrated communications practice that blends media relations with digital.
What they do now
Social & influencer programs, SEO via content, and paid campaigns alongside press work—so one team can launch your story in media and amplify it online.
Why it works in Japan
Trust moves the market here; long-standing media relationships and consistent storytelling help brands earn that trust before performance spend scales.
Best fit
Launches and reputation-sensitive categories (finance, health, B2B tech) that need press credibility + digital lift under one roof.
CyberAgent — Japan’s ad-tech workhorse
If you want scaled performance advertising in Japan, CyberAgent is hard to beat. The internet ads business is its core and the company sits among the top share leaders in Japan’s digital ad market —alongside the big network groups.
What they actually do
- Full-funnel media ops across Google, Yahoo! JAPAN, LINE, YouTube, TikTok, and Meta—with deep programmatic chops.
- AI-driven creative & optimization: the in-house Kiwami Prediction suite predicts performance and even generates ad assets in Japanese—cutting time and lifting conversion efficiency.
- Owned media synergies: runs ABEMA (major streaming platform) and the long-running Ameba blogging network, giving extra inventory and audience insight.
Where they shine
High-volume UA / e-commerce with rapid testing and aggressive CPA control.
Good fit
Apps, gaming, fashion/CPG, and any brand needing large-scale reach—plus Japan-specific channels and cultural timing baked in. If you need brand storytelling and PR as a primary, pick a PR-led shop, CyberAgent is built for it.
Hakuhodo Marketing Systems — strategy, systems, and steady growth
Part of the Hakuhodo DY Group (Japan’s #2 agency group; global top-10), Hakuhodo Marketing Systems (HMS) was set up in 2018 to do one thing well: design, build, and run the digital marketing environment for large brands in Japan. Think strategy + MarTech + ongoing operations under one roof.
What they actually does
- Plan the stack: digital strategy tied to sei-katsu-sha insight (Hakuhodo’s people-first philosophy).
- Build the stack: sites/LPs, analytics dashboards, CRM/DMP/MA integration—so data flows and teams can act.
- Run & improve: day-to-day campaign operations with continuous optimization (small starts → constant upgrades).
Why it matters
For organizations past “test ads,” HMS engineers the system that keeps performance compounding—aligning media, tech, and measurement with enterprise governance.
Best fit
Established brands (JP or global) needing a sustainable, locally-optimized digital infrastructure—not just a campaign burst. If your brief reads “connect web, CRM, and media and make it work in Japan,” HMS is built for that.
How to Choose the Right Digital Marketing Agency in Japan

Pick fast, but pick right. Use this short checklist to separate a good pitch from a good partner.
1) Goals first, channels second
Be explicit: do you need SEO visibility (Google + Yahoo! JAPAN), paid demand now, social reach (LINE / YouTube / X), or an integrated plan? In Japan, Google leads but Yahoo! JAPAN still holds ~9–11%—so your plan should reflect both where searchers actually are.
2) Japan-native, bilingual team
You’re not translating—you’re localizing for trust. Insist on native Japanese practitioners and English-capable leads, so strategy is clear in English and execution lands naturally in Japanese. Remember: LINE reaches ~96–97M users in Japan—your team must know how people really use it.
3) Proof over promises
Ask for comparable wins (industry/size), with numbers and timeframes. Case studies should show the problem → plan → KPI lift (e.g., rankings, CPA, revenue), not generic claims. Third-party reviews or verified interviews help.
4) The right size for your needs
Big networks excel at nationwide, multi-channel orchestration; boutiques give senior focus and speed. If you’re a smaller account at a giant shop, ask who’s on your day-to-day. If it’s a boutique, confirm capacity and SLAs.
5) Transparency & access
Monthly reporting in your language, shared ad/analytics access, and frank commentary on what’s working (and what isn’t). If answers are vague now, they’ll be vague later.
6) Japan-specific competence
Teams should fluently cover Yahoo! JAPAN Ads and Google Ads (separate buying), and know how LINE fits your funnel (CRM, ads, messaging). If the plan ignores Yahoo or treats LINE as an afterthought, it’s a red flag.
7) Budget model clarity
Know whether fees are retainer, % of spend, or project-based, and what’s included (Japanese copy, landing pages, creative rounds). Cheap and generic usually costs more later.
8) Chemistry and cadence
You’ll work closely across time zones. Look for a partner that operates like an extension of your team—proactive, reachable, and aligned on weekly/quarterly rhythms.
Bottom line: choose the agency that can prove Japan-native execution, explain how your goals map to Google + Yahoo! JAPAN and LINE, and show measurable wins for companies like yours. That mix—local craft, channel reality, and evidence—is what actually moves the numbers in Japan.
